Output 3c868b491e99efd14119931a9c5961ffe03f6343826849f02531e37bb2936da0: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b31d191513b077c7271752e88f584b1ddcee7f7 OP_EQUAL
address
35dQfFX13MnuZafbqrBPUA1C1gDzspjeAZ
transaction
3c868b491e99efd14119931a9c5961ffe03f6343826849f02531e37bb2936da0
confirmations
444216
spent
true